Conversion formula
The conversion factor from deciliters to cubic inches is 6.1023743836666, which means that 1 deciliter is equal to 6.1023743836666 cubic inches:
1 dL = 6.1023743836666 in3
To convert 1948 deciliters into cubic inches we have to multiply 1948 by the conversion factor in order to get the volume amount from deciliters to cubic inches. We can also form a simple proportion to calculate the result:
1 dL → 6.1023743836666 in3
1948 dL → V(in3)
Solve the above proportion to obtain the volume V in cubic inches:
V(in3) = 1948 dL × 6.1023743836666 in3
V(in3) = 11887.425299383 in3
The final result is:
1948 dL → 11887.425299383 in3
We conclude that 1948 deciliters is equivalent to 11887.425299383 cubic inches:
1948 deciliters = 11887.425299383 cubic inches
